In recent years, a new trend in the toy world has captured the imagination of children and adults alike: squishy toys. These adorable soft, sticky objects have won the hearts of millions around the world, providing a unique sensory experience and fun way to relieve stress. In this article, we'll explore the phenomenon of squishy toys, their history, the variety of shapes and styles available, and why they've gained so much popularity.
A squishy toy is a toy made from a soft material, usually a polyurethane foam or silicone gel. They can take many forms, from foods to animals to cartoon characters and so much more. The defining characteristic of squishy toys is their ability to deform when squeezed and slowly return to their original shape, allowing users to squeeze, squeeze and manipulate the toy as they please.

Squishy toys originated in Japan (come on, don't tell me), where they are known as "squishy toys" or "soft toys". Over the years, they have become extremely popular with Japanese youth, due to their soft texture and the variety of shapes and colors available. Since then, the trend has spread across the globe, with squishy toys reaching the hands of kids and adults of all ages.
One of the main reasons squishy toys have gained so much traction is the unique sensory experience they offer. Squeezing a squishy toy and feeling it slowly return to its original shape can be extremely satisfying for people of all ages. The squeezing action of the toy can help relax and reduce stress, providing a form of relief that can be especially helpful for hyperactive children or those looking for a way to take their mind off everyday worries.

One of the fascinating features of squishy toys is their wide range of available shapes and styles. There are squishy toys in the shape of sweets, fruits, animals, cartoon characters and even inanimate objects. This variety allows people to find the squishy toy that best represents their personal tastes and interests. In addition, many squishy toys are designed with impressive precision, with realistic details that make them even more fascinating.
In addition to their visual appearance, squishy toys can also have light scents, such as the scent of sweets or fruit, which add an extra sensory element to the overall experience.
Squishy toys have taken the toy world by storm thanks to their irresistible appeal and unique sensory experience they offer. Whether you're a kid or an adult, squeezing a squishy toy can be a fun way to relieve stress, improve mental well-being, and have fun. With their variety of shapes, styles and scents, squishy toys continue to fascinate people of all ages around the world, bringing a touch of softness and joy into the lives of anyone who encounters them.
Squishies have inspired many people to create their own handmade versions. There are tutorials online on how to make homemade squishies using materials like sponge, glue, and dyes.
